Now, I listened to West Ryder casually on the internet before it came out - my thoughts were that it was nothing special. Saying that, I bought it on Monday and I think it's absolutely brilliant.
I'm no sucker to Kasabian either. Their first album was good, but nothing more than that. Empire, to me personally, was fucking horrific. Only the songs Empire and The Doberman were of any quality.
So you could forgive me for any previous posts of me saying they were a distinctively average band and that West Ryder is average.
I just love the whole concept of it being set in a mental institution and the variety of musical instruments on offer (something I crave for in Oasis). I love the orchestration and everything, plus Tom Meighan's singing is less laddish than on the previous records. I'm not going to go far and say they're a great band, because one brilliant record doesn't make you great, but they have certainly got themselves on the right track. Album of the year so far, no doubt.
